Love lakes? Fond of forests? Penchant for painting? This top spot ticks every box. This woodland wonder of a site is right to next to a lake, the very same Lac du Pont à l’Age, a body of water so clear and easy on the eye you’ll be surprised to hear it’s manmade. You’ll spot it shimmering away through the trees all around this spacious forested site in Limousin, tempting you down for a paddle. The lake is the hidden gem of this French site, obvs, but it’s got other things to crow about. Ice creams, drinks and snacks are dished up down at the water, along with belly-busting brasserie fare at the bar-restaurant. The recreation room beckons with its bar, table football and TV for indoor types, while the evening entertainment and activities for kids run throughout the summer months for those who like their antics handily arranged for them. A playground is also on site. And as for the bigger, watery playground? Well, you’re moments away from sunning on the lake beach, fishing the waters or hiring pedalos, canoes and kayaks to traverse the waves. The lake makes for a splendid sunset stroll as well, especially if you head further along to see the dam and waterfall. It’s a five-minute drive from here to the villages of Folles and Laurière for drinks, eats and groceries.

Local attractions

If you’re planning to spend a long time holed up in this forest idyll (and why not?) you might need to stock up in the bigger shops and supermarkets of Limoges (40 minutes’ drive). It’s well worth a day trip or two in any case, to visit the wildlife park inside the castle, stroll round the massive aquarium and see the cathedral it took six centuries to finish. If you’re more into scenery than the city, a drive of 50 minutes gets you to Crozant, the arty hub for the Valley of the Painters. In the 19th century, Monet and hordes of other artists flocked to this spot where the Creuse and Sédelle rivers join under a ruined white castle. It’s every bit as paintable now so bring your crayons, peruse the artistic history in the visitor centre or just wander the numerous trails taking it all in. (Boat trips on the Creuse give you another perspective with less legwork.) For wildlife watching, it’s around 50 minutes' drive from the site to the Parc Naturel Régional de la Brenne, a diverse wilderness of wetlands, prairies and moors home to such exotica as pond turtles and purple herons. There’s even wilder stuff of the tooth-bearing, treetop-grazing kind at Zoo Parc Reynou (also 50 minutes), while the furry team at Les Loups de Chabrières an hour away will have you wanting to take a wolf pack home with you.
